CRUD - 2

Jiwon·2021년 7월 7일
0

데이터베이스

목록 보기
3/6
post-custom-banner

ALTER TABLE 테이블이름 (ADD/DROP/MODIFY) 필드명 필드유형 (제약조건);

ALTER TABLE

  • ADD : 새로운 필드 추가
  • DROP : 기존 필드 삭제
  • MODIFY : 필드 타입 변경


필드 타입이 바뀐걸 볼 수 있다.

ALTER TABLE 테이블명 ADD 필드명 필드유형 제약조건(AUTO_INCREMENT);

id나 number같은 필드는 자동으로 정수를 올려주면서 유일성을 보장해줘야 한다.
따라서 인덱스(정수값)을 체크해서 자동으로 올려주는 옵션 AUTO_INCREMENT 설정

UPDATE 테이블명 SET 필드명,수정할 값;

특정 데이터를 수정할 때 사용

DELETE FROM 테이블명 WHERE 필드명=데이터 값;

특정 데이터를 삭제할 때 사용


그냥 테이블명만 쓰면 테이블에 있는 데이터가 다 날라간다

DROP TABLE 테이블명;

테이블을 삭제하고 싶을 때 사용


개발을 하다보면 고성능을 지원하기 위해서 병렬 프로그래밍을 해야 한다.
여러 요청과 처리를 동시에 받아서 처리하는 프로그램을 만들어야 한다.
-> 원자적 연산을 사용하면 중간에 문제가 생길 여지를 없앨 수 있기 때문

이 부분에 대해서는 다음 글에 이어서 적도록 하겠음

CRUD 의미

대부분의 컴퓨터소프트웨어가 가지는 기본적인 기능인 데이터 처리 기능을 CRUD라고 한다.
Create
Read
Update
Delete

레코드를 CRUD하는 방법은
Create -> Insert (데이터 생성 작업)
Read -> Select (데이터 조회 작업)
Update -> Update (데이터 수정 작업)
Delete -> Delete (데이터 삭제 작업)

profile
과연 나는 ?
post-custom-banner

0개의 댓글